Archives for https://www.indiewire.com/news/business/ted-sarandos-china-censorship-board-1235117902/

Page 1 out of 1





Website image URL of site archived Date archivedArchive type
https://www.indiewire.com/news/business/ted-sarandos-china-censorship-board-1235117902/Sat, 26 Apr 2025 04:00:09 GMT Archived webpage